    "Your Business LIFE and working CAREER focus on the Journey WITH Your destination in Mind"

    Many times our focus is in the wrong direction.  Same goes for the entrepreneur working in his/her business.  Every business needs a leader, the owner or a key person focused ON the future, planning, setting goals to achieve, hiring talented staff and more. 

    Too often, employees fail to focus long-term on personal career goals.  A job is offered and accepted without much thought as to what the job entails or performance required or expected in the new position.  Usually, the owner or hiring authority has no training or skills in assessing new emloyees.  He/she is poorly trained in hiring personnel, training is by the "seat of the pants" rather than professional experience and knowledge. 

    Do what you LOVE to do... make your hobby your vocation instead of hating your work and your employer for hiring you for the job.  If you're grumbling, don't want to get out of bed and go to work... get out of there now.  Better career positions are waiting, search for it, seek them out for your long-term success.
